For a long time antennas for handsets were seen as a necessary piece of wire at the end of a high tech system. Due to a strong demand for better performance, lower price and better design the antenna element is becoming more and more the focus of interest. This paper gives an overview of some actual trends of today´s handset antennas. The interaction with the user, the technology of integrated antennas and multiband antenna concepts are explained.
